Tabla de Contenido
El amigo invisible es una tradición que se lleva a cabo en muchas ocasiones especiales, como Navidad o cumpleaños, donde un grupo de personas deciden dar regalos sorpresa entre ellos. Este juego consiste en sortear y asignar a cada persona un amigo secreto al cual deberá regalar un presente, manteniendo su identidad en secreto hasta el día de la entrega. Para hacer el sorteo del amigo invisible de manera rápida y efectiva, se puede utilizar HTML para crear una aplicación sencilla de generación aleatoria de asignaciones. A continuación, te mostraremos cómo hacerlo.
1. Preparativos
Antes de empezar con el sorteo, es importante establecer algunas reglas básicas. Por ejemplo, define un presupuesto máximo para los regalos y decide si quieres establecer algún tipo de temática para los obsequios. También es importante establecer una fecha límite para la entrega de los regalos y decidir si quieres organizar un evento especial para la apertura de los mismos.
Una vez tengas todas las reglas claras, es hora de empezar con la creación del código HTML. Puedes utilizar un editor de texto como Sublime Text o Notepad++ para ello. Crea un archivo nuevo con extensión .html y empieza a escribir el código.
2. Creación del formulario
El primer paso es crear un formulario donde los participantes puedan introducir sus nombres y datos de contacto. Para ello, utiliza la etiqueta
Recuerda agregar la etiqueta
para que los campos se muestren en líneas separadas. También puedes agregar algunos estilos CSS para mejorar la apariencia del formulario.
3. Generación aleatoria de asignaciones
Una vez que los participantes hayan enviado sus datos a través del formulario, es hora de generar las asignaciones de los amigos secretos. Para ello, puedes utilizar JavaScript junto con HTML para crear un código que realice esta tarea de forma aleatoria.
Primero, crea una función de JavaScript que se ejecute cuando el formulario sea enviado. Dentro de esta función, obtén los valores introducidos por los participantes utilizando el método getElementById. Luego, crea un array con los nombres de los participantes y utiliza la función Math.random para generar un índice aleatorio.
Para asignar a cada participante un amigo secreto, puedes utilizar un bucle for que recorra el array de nombres y, en cada iteración, elija un índice aleatorio que corresponderá al amigo secreto asignado.
Una vez que hayas generado todas las asignaciones, puedes mostrarlas en pantalla utilizando la etiqueta
de HTML. Puedes utilizar el método document.getElementById para seleccionar un elemento HTML donde mostrar las asignaciones y utilizar la propiedad .innerHTML para modificar el contenido de dicho elemento.
Por ejemplo:
En este ejemplo, la función generarAsignaciones se ejecuta cuando el formulario es enviado. Dentro de esta función, se genera un array con los nombres de los participantes y se recorre con un bucle for para asignarles amigos secretos. Luego, se muestra el resultado en la etiqueta
con id «resultado».
4. Envío de asignaciones por correo electrónico
Una vez que tengas las asignaciones generadas, puedes enviarlas por correo electrónico a cada participante de manera automática. Para ello, puedes utilizar un servicio de envío de correos como SMTP.js.
Primero, agrega el archivo smtp.js a tu proyecto HTML y enlázalo en tu documento utilizando la etiqueta . Luego, crea una función de JavaScript que se ejecute cuando el formulario sea enviado y, dentro de esta función, utiliza el método Email.send para enviar las asignaciones.
Por ejemplo:
En este ejemplo, se utiliza la función Email.send para enviar las asignaciones por correo electrónico. Es importante obtener un SecureToken desde smtp.js para poder enviar correos desde tu cuenta de correo electrónico. Recuerda reemplazar "tu_token_seguro", "tucorreo@example.com" y otros valores con los tuyos propios.
Ahora que sabes cómo hacer el sorteo del amigo invisible utilizando HTML, podrás organizar esta divertida tradición de forma rápida y sencilla. Recuerda que lo más importante es disfrutar del juego y compartir buenos momentos con tus amigos y seres queridos. ¡Feliz amigo invisible!
También te puede interesar
- El comando "Ok Google" es muy utilizado y puede ser utilizado para configurar un dispositivo nuevo o para copiar la configuración de un dispositivo a otro.
- También se puede utilizar para configurar un dispositivo cercano compatible con el Asistente de Google, el cual se puede identificar por las etiquetas "Made for Google", "Made by Google" o "Vínculo Rápido
- Los +100 Mejores Comandos para el Asistente de Google, Ok Google (Actualizados).
Apasionada de la Tecnología, aprender y compartir mi conocimiento y experiencia, es lo más gratificante.
Yaiza es "adicta a la tecnología" que ama todo lo relacionado con ella.
También es una experta en el uso de la tecnología para hacer su vida más fácil, y le encanta compartir consejos y trucos con los demás.